1977-78 Geneva Panthers

Head Coach: Mr. Knisely
Asst. Coach: Mr. Astles

Record: 5 Wins, 7 Losses

 


1977-78 Geneva Panthers Varsity Wrestling Team

FRONT ROW: Richard VanDeMortel, Ray Watt, Vaighan Nelson, John Scalzo, John Augustine, Tom Moses. BACK ROW: Mr. Astles, Matt Astles, Matt George, Mark Abraham, Keith Aten, Harvey Palmer, John Cosentino, Phil Durso, Dan Miller, Mr. Knisely. (SOURCE: Seneca Saga, Geneva High School, 1978. Photo courtesy of the Geneva Historical Society.)


Since last year, the varsity wrestling squad has shown improvement and can boast two outstanding wrestlers on this 1977-78 roster, co-captains John Scalzo and Ray Watt. Scalzo was names outstanding wrestler at the Webster and Newark tournaments this year, the first time ever a GHS wrestler has won that award twice. He has won the Webster tournament three years in a row, never giving up a point in that competition. In fact, John RARELY gives up a point. To date this year, he has yielded a total of only four, being undefeated in duals 11-0 and having an overall record of 17-1.

Ray Watt also won the Webster tourney in his class and placed first in last year's Newark competition. Ray is 11-0 in duals and 16-2 overall. Both Ray and John hope that their hard work this year will end in sectional titles.

Other wrestlers who did well in 1977-78 include Jack Augustine, Tom Moses, Tom Moracco, and John Consentino. (Seneca Saga, 1978)

Dual Meets

 

Geneva 44, Hornell 21
Geneva 33, Penn Yan 36
Geneva 28, Wayne 38
Geneva  9, Canandaigua 63
Geneva 17, Elmira Free 39
Geneva 56, Midlakes 13
Geneva 45, Corning West 12
Geneva 31, Waterloo 38
Geneva 22, Newark 48
Geneva 51, Victor 26
Geneva 33, Palmyra-Macedon 29
Geneva 9, Mynderse 55
